Multistate Bar Examination Practice Question

A tenant entered into a one-year lease with a landlord for a residential apartment, agreeing to pay rent on the first of each month. After three months, the tenant vacates the apartment without notifying the landlord and ceases paying rent. The landlord does not make any effort to re-let the apartment for four months and then sues the tenant for unpaid rent for the entire lease term. Under modern landlord-tenant law, what is the landlord most likely entitled to recover?

  • The landlord may lose entitlement to unpaid rent if the lease is formally terminated by the tenant's abandonment.

  • Rent for the months the landlord made reasonable efforts to re-let the apartment.

  • Rent based on the length of the lease and the tenant's early departure.

  • Use of the security deposit as a portion of unpaid rent recovery.
